## Local Setup — Eventspine Schema Registry

Clone the registry, run `make bootstrap`, then start the compatibility checker. Register a test schema before the weekly sync so we can demo evolution rules. Compatibility mode defaults to BACKWARD; don't change it locally. The registry persists subjects and versions in Postgres. Point your local instance at the shared dev database with this connection string.

replica DSN, kajep-yahag: mssql://praok_svc:iF@db-8d68.plorvaio.local:5432/eliion

Handover Note – Directors' Transition, Quillon Analytics

For the board's record: the licensing dispute with Harwick Media remains unresolved. Counsel believes our usage of the Cartel dataset falls within the 2022 agreement, but Harwick contests the renewal clause. I have kept correspondence measured and documented; my successor should avoid conceding scope before mediation in the spring. All files are indexed in the legal folder. One confidential strategic consideration follows directly below.

board note of yadup-fajef: Druiusox Holdings is in early talks to buy Norwynek Systems for about $186.0 million. The Kaseth launch date is June 24, and nothing goes to the press before then. Legal wants the Quenethek Group term sheet withdrawn before November 27.

# -----------------------------------------------------------------
# Health-check knobs for services sitting behind the Larkmoor LB.
#
# Plugin authors: if your plugin adds an endpoint, it inherits these
# probe settings automatically. Don't override them unless your
# startup is genuinely slow — the LB will mark you unhealthy and
# your users will blame us, not you. Timeouts are in seconds,
# counts are consecutive probes. The values we ship by default are
# defined just below.

limits module of tahof-tawig:
WEIGHTS = {
    "fenwyn": 285,
    "briiel": 528,
    "druiel": 1023,
    "kasax": 747,
    "jordor": 334,
}

Ticket: Unlock migration vault for Ironvine ORM refactor

New team members: the legacy Ironvine ORM layer is being replaced module by module, and the schema snapshots needed for safe refactoring sit in a locked vault nobody has opened since the last owner left. We recovered the credentials from escrow this week. The passphrase follows below.

unlock words, kajog-yawip: istwyn-casath-aldok